Yorkies are susceptible to ear infections that can be caused by either too much moisture or water in the air. Keep an eye on these problems, and schedule regular ear cleanings to prevent them.

Like other small breeds, Cayden yorkshire kaufen​ Terriers are prone to oral and dental issues. Their small mouths may suffer from overcrowding, which could trap food particles, bacteria, and minerals between the teeth. This can cause gum disease and eventually adult tooth loss if not addressed. It is essential to clean your Yorkshire Terrier's dental health regularly, and they should see an animal veterinarian regularly for dental cleanings.

Like all breeds, Yorkies are prone to certain health conditions. However, regular veterinary treatment and preventative measures can significantly lower the chance of developing these ailments.

The painful degenerative hip condition Legg-Calve-Perthes is more prevalent in young Yorkies. This is a condition that occurs when there is not enough blood flowing to the femoral heads situated at the tops of the thighs. This can cause pain, inflammation, and lameness in one or both rear legs.

Another issue that is common to Britta yorkshire terrier welpen kaufen​ Terriers is tracheal collapsing, which is when the ring of cartilage that makes up the trachea is flattened. It can be caused by trauma, illness or age-related wear.
